Skip to content

add interruptibleReader,can interrupt file upload or download #12

add interruptibleReader,can interrupt file upload or download

add interruptibleReader,can interrupt file upload or download #12

Workflow file for this run

# This workflow will build a golang project
# For more information see: https://docs.github.com/en/actions/automating-builds-and-tests/building-and-testing-go
name: Go
on:
push:
branches: ["main"]
pull_request:
branches: ["main"]
jobs:
build: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- name: Set up Go
uses: actions/setup-go@v5
with:
go-version: "1.23"
- name: Use Node.js
uses: actions/setup-node@v4
with:
node-version: 23
- name: Install Gox
run: go install github.com/mitchellh/gox@latest
- name: Install Wails
run: go install github.com/wailsapp/wails/v2/cmd/wails@latest
- name: Install Task
uses: arduino/setup-task@v2
- name: Build Frontend
run: task build_frontend
- name: Test
shell: pwsh
run: task test
- name: Build
shell: pwsh
run: task build